### Step 6 — Sign the occupancy feed release

Almost done. The Carhaven garage occupancy feed publishes over the Strand relay, and the relay won't accept unsigned snapshots — good news for you, since tampered counts were the big worry in last quarter's review. Build the feed bundle, run the integrity check, and confirm the hash matches the manifest. Then sign the bundle so the relay trusts it, using the key that follows.

rollout seal: bky9_PeXH1fTLY

☐ Step 7 — Spoolhaven signing key rotation: confirm both custodians are present, verify the printer-spooler microservice build hash against the ceremony record, then insert the rotation token. When the console prompts for vault recovery, the designated reader states the recovery passphrase aloud while the scribe records it. The passphrase follows.

recovery phrase for bawef-kagug: casix-tamvan-lamath-holeth-gilmir-drudor-julax-wenok-wenael-rusvan-holax-goriel-frawyn

14:32 — Timeline entry, Orderfall incident. Turns out the "missing" orders weren't missing at all: a migration flipped the soft-delete flag on about 1,200 rows in the orders table, so our API quietly filtered them out. Plugin authors, heads up — if your extension queries orders directly instead of through the Cratewise SDK, you saw ghosts too. We've restored the flags and added a guard. The SDK handles soft deletes for you, so please migrate. The fix shipped under the token below.

trace token, fafog-kageg: htk4_98e6